That's bacteria, get it out and dip dip dip. Can you frag out the healthy polyps?
 
That is brown jelly shoot of power head take out the Coral frag the dead part and quarantine the live piece
 
Not sure I can explain why that is happening. Sometimes colonies like that don't like any type of change. Water parameters, light, fish nipping at it.

If you don't mind fragging it into frags of 2-3 heads each, it will most likely come around and start growing again. More times than not that will help save your coral. After you frag it dip it in Revive to clean any infection or pest off it.
